Quote by Peter Guber

Beside every great success are the seeds of enormous failure. In every failure, theres the opportunity seeds of great success. Theyre not miles apart. So if theyre that close together, and if youre really working, youre always gonna have that likelihood that somethings not going to work. – Peter Guber
